5.6 Management Control Information
Overview
The
Management Control Information
provides you with detailed information
about your selected client device, and also provides you with some hardware
controlled management functions such as power control options for devices which
do not have an OS installed yet.
The Management Control Information for DASH, vPro, RTL8117, and BMC may
differ from each other.

To access
Management Control Information
of a client device, please refer to
one of the following methods:
•
Classic view: Click on a client device in the device list, then select
Hardware
in the
Mode
dropdown menu, or click on in the M.C
column of the Devices List.
• Graphic view: Double click on a client device shortcut icon, then select
Hardware
in the
Mode
dropdown menu.
• Management Control: Click on a client device in the scan results of the
Management Control
screen.
• Some options are only available when the client device is online and
logged into the OS.
• You will not be able to toggle between
Hardware
and
Software
mode
if you accessed the
Management Control Information
page through
Management Control
or by clicking on in the M.C column of the
Devices List on the main menu page.
• This chapter is only for the
Hardware Mode
options, for
Software Mode
options, please refer to
Chapter 4 Device Information
.
Remote Management Controller support on the motherboard is required for
Management Control Information.
